What does a reception admin do?

A reception admin is responsible for managing front desk operations, including greeting visitors, answering phone calls, scheduling appointments, and handling administrative tasks such as data entry and correspondence. They often use office software and require good communication and organizational skills to ensure smooth office functioning.
